Pakistani player's big charge on Shahid Afridi, he ruined my ODI career

New Delhi : Former Pakistan cricket team spinner Danish Kaneria accused Shahid Afridi of misbehaving with him during his career and also blamed him for his short career at Limited Overs. Danish was the second Hindu player to play cricket for Pakistan. He took 261 wickets in 61 Tests while played only 18 ODIs between 2000 and 2010. Anil Dalpat was the first Hindu player to play cricket for Pakistan.


The 39-year-old Danish said that why did Afridi treat me like this and what was the reason behind this, it is very difficult for him to think if religion is not there. He said that Afridi was always against him when we used to play together in domestic cricket or ODI cricket. He said that when one person is always against you, what else can be the reason other than religion in it.

Danish Kaneria supported Shoaib Akhtar's claim last year that he was discriminated against because of religion in the team. He said that he could play more than 18 matches, but that could not happen due to Afridi. When Afridi was also captain in domestic cricket, I could not get much opportunities and in ODIs he did the same without any reason. He used to support others but not me.

Kaneria said that I was a regular member of ODI, but I could not get a chance. I was a leg spinner and Afridi also used to do leg spin and that was another reason. He was a big star of Pakistan and was playing continuously, yet I could not understand why he used to treat me like this. He used to say that two spinners cannot play in the playing XI.
